Just a word of caution for you - to keep your goal and expectation reasonable.. 50lbs in just about 6 months given your current weight is a lot to shoot for - a reasonable goal is 1 percent of your body weight a week.... some weeks you might get rewarded with more, some weeks you might end up with less - it just works out that way... our bodies don't always cooperate :D especially the lower your weight gets...

Really focus on the building new habits and changing your existing habits instead of just a number on the scale...
